Пользовательская таблица маршрутов для конкретного приложения?

Я в сети с двумя интернет-соединениями. Один из них – глобальный доступ к корпоративной сети (с пользовательскими правилами брандмауэра), второй – прямое подключение к Интернету.

По умолчанию все сообщения направляются на соединение wan (маршрут по умолчанию к wan-маршрутизатору). Я могу настроить маршруты к прямому интернет-соединению на основе классической целевой сети / ip / mask для определенного маршрутизатора.

Возможно ли иметь настраиваемый маршрут для определенного приложения, а не конкретный IP-адрес? На самом деле, я не знаю, каковы исходящие IP-адреса, используемые APP, и я должен использовать его напрямую для подключения к Интернету. Приложение, к сожалению, не поддерживает прокси-сервер (и протокол является проприетарным).

  • Инструмент для мониторинга сетевого трафика в Windows 7 Home
  • Случайно удалил папку «Загрузки», окно «Специальная папка», как восстановить?
  • Как добавить параметр для установки обновлений и перезагрузки в Windows 7?
  • Интернет и электронная почта
  • Windows: отключить кеширование больших файлов
  • Невозможно выбрать форму программы по умолчанию, открытую с помощью контекстного меню в Windows 7
  • Автоматически загружать файлы в Internet Explorer без запроса на сохранение / отмену?
  • Указанный модуль не удалось найти (удалить)
  • 3 Solutions collect form web for “Пользовательская таблица маршрутов для конкретного приложения?”

    ForceBindIP – утилита, которая перехватывает внутренние вызовы winsock приложения. Веб-сайт не требует поддержки Win7, но он, похоже, работает на моей тестовой системе ( netstat показал, что мое выбранное приложение действительно связано с альтернативным локальным IP-адресом, который я предоставил). Это только 32-разрядная версия, и если ваше приложение не использует стандартные вызовы сокетов Windows, вам не повезло.

    Как насчет виртуальной машины? Создайте второй экземпляр ОС с помощью VMWare Player (есть бесплатная версия) или VirtualBox, и вы можете перенаправить виртуальный сетевой адаптер, который он использует прямо на прямое подключение к Интернету. Затем для любого приложения, которое вы хотите обходить WAN без отдельной маршрутизации, просто запустите его на виртуальной машине. Возможно, это не самое элегантное решение, но если у вас есть только несколько приложений, где традиционная маршрутизация ip / port не будет работать, это может быть способ пойти.

    Если вы захотите потратить небольшую рабочую станцию ​​VMWare, есть функция «Единство», которая может сделать работу между всеми вашими приложениями более плавной. Также проверьте на Microsoft Virtual PC. Если вы работаете в Windows 7 Professional или выше, вы даже можете использовать XP Mode для этого (при условии, что ваше приложение обратно совместимо).

    Спасибо за ваши ответы.

    Я, наконец, использовал монитор сети Microsoft для поиска целевых IP-адресов, затем вручную настроил маршруты для этих целей. Существует около 45 целевых IP-адресов! 🙁

    Давайте будем гением компьютера.